What is content? Content is mostly thought of as information on websites. It's a written article, a video clip, audio clip or an image. This can be static information or it can reside in a database and delivered dynamically.
What about data from a database other than the one connected to the website, such as a list of individuals who sing in the choir, real time financial information from an accounting system, Attendance statistics, the people I need to followup with that visited the church, etc. This information should be available to the people who need to see it but not anyone else and it should be available through a website.

Content is information. It doesn't matter if it the Pastor's latest sermon, members of a committee, pictures of kids, audio clips, financial data from the General Ledger, last weeks attendance or any other information that's important to the church. Content should be available to display on the website and it should be relevant to who I am.
